+import org.apache.cxf.phase.AbstractPhaseInterceptor; +import org.apache.cxf.phase.Phase; +import org.apache.cxf.security.SecurityContext; +import org.apache.cxf.security.transport.TLSSessionInfo; + +public class TLSAuthenticationInterceptor extends AbstractPhaseInterceptor { + public static final String AUTHORIZATION_TYPE_TLS = "TLSAuthenticatedHandshake"; + + private static final Logger LOG = LogUtils.getL7dLogger(TLSAuthenticationInterceptor.class); + + private String userNameKey; + private boolean useDoAs; + private boolean reportFault; + private TLSSecuritySubjectProvider subjectProvider = new DefaultTLSSecuritySubjectProvider(); + + public TLSAuthenticationInterceptor() { + super(Phase.UNMARSHAL); + addBefore(JAASLoginInterceptor.class.getName()); + } + + public TLSAuthenticationInterceptor(String phase) { + super(phase); + } + + public void handleMessage(final Message message) throws Fault { + Subject subject = null; + String userName = null; + + try { + X509Certificate certificate = getCertificate(message); + userName = getUserName(certificate); + + subject = subjectProvider.getSubject(userName, certificate); + SecurityContext context = new DefaultSecurityContext(userName, subject); + + message.put(SecurityContext.class, context); + + if (useDoAs) { + Subject.doAs(subject, new PrivilegedAction() { + + @Override + public Void run() { + InterceptorChain chain = message.getInterceptorChain(); + if (chain != null) { + chain.doIntercept(message); + } + return null; + } + }); + } + + } catch (SecurityException ex) { + String errorMessage = "TLS Certificate processing failed for '" + userName + "' : " + ex.getMessage(); + LOG.fine(errorMessage); + if (isReportFault()) { + throw new AuthenticationException(errorMessage); + } else { + throw new AuthenticationException("TLS Certificate processing failed " + + "(details can be found in server log)"); + } + } + } + + /** + * Extracts certificate from message, expecting to find TLSSessionInfo + * inside. + * + * @param message + * @return + */ + protected X509Certificate getCertificate(Message message) { + TLSSessionInfo tlsSessionInfo = message.get(TLSSessionInfo.class); + if (tlsSessionInfo == null) { + throw new SecurityException("Not TLS connection"); + } + + Certificate[] certificates = tlsSessionInfo.getPeerCertificates(); + if (certificates == null || certificates.length == 0) { + throw new SecurityException("No certificate found"); + } + + // Due to RFC5246, senders certificates always comes 1st + return (X509Certificate) certificates[0]; + } + + /** + * Returns Subject DN from X509Certificate + * + * @param certificate + * @return Subject DN as a user name + */ + protected String getUserName(X509Certificate certificate) { + String dn = certificate.getSubjectDN().getName(); + + if (getUserNameKey() == null) { + return dn; + } + + LdapName ldapDn; + try { + ldapDn = new LdapName(dn); + } catch (InvalidNameException e) { + throw new SecurityException("Invalid DN"); + } + + for (Rdn rdn : ldapDn.getRdns()) { + if (getUserNameKey().equalsIgnoreCase(rdn.getType())) { + return (String) rdn.getValue(); + } + } + + throw new SecurityException("No " + getUserNameKey() + " key found in certificate DN: " + dn); + } + + public boolean getUseDoAs() { + return useDoAs; + } + + public void setUseDoAs(boolean useDoAs) { + this.useDoAs = useDoAs; + } + + public TLSSecuritySubjectProvider getSubjectProvider() { + return subjectProvider; + } + + public void setSubjectProvider(TLSSecuritySubjectProvider subjectProvider) { + this.subjectProvider = subjectProvider; + } + + public String getUserNameKey() { + return userNameKey; + } + + public void setUserNameKey(String userNameKey) { + this.userNameKey = userNameKey; + } + + public boolean isReportFault() { + return reportFault; + } + + public void setReportFault(boolean reportFault) { + this.reportFault = reportFault; + } + + private class DefaultTLSSecuritySubjectProvider extends TLSSecuritySubjectProvider { + + @Override + public Subject getSubject(String userName, X509Certificate certificate) throws SecurityException { + return createSubject(userName, null);
